About the role:

This is an exciting opportunity to work in a fast-paced, multi-stakeholder environment where you will be responsible for ensuring high-quality uniforms meet technical and compliance standards. As a Senior Garment Technician, you will lead the development of specifications and oversee the engineering lifecycle from tech pack to pre-production sample sign-off.

The ideal candidate will have minimum 8 years' experience in a technical and/or quality engineering role within apparel or textiles. You will have tertiary qualifications in Product Design, Garment Manufacturing, Engineering, or Apparel Development – or equivalent industry experience/apprenticeship (preferred). Your expertise in apparel construction, patterns, trims, and product development processes will enable you to create accurate specifications and support the team with technical expertise.

Key responsibilities:

  • Own the development and delivery of accurate specifications from tech pack handover through to pre-production sample approval.
  • Establish and maintain systems and processes required to support all engineering activities.
  • Assign authority and support for configuration and engineering tasks across the team.
  • Oversee the creation and maintenance of tech packs and ensure correct trims selection to support manufacturing accuracy.
  • Request and review development samples, assess quality, fit, and compliance, and ensure early intervention where required.
  • Coordinate and participate in product fittings to ensure size, fit, and specification compliance.
  • Conduct and support risk assessments, product testing, and resolution of quality issues.
  • Represent the company in Configuration Control Boards (CCB) and ensure technical accuracy and documentation control.
  • Provide coaching and mentorship across the technical team, offering support on troubleshooting and best practice.
